Output 3fd89f3ff156143de936f89bad7523d3dc2e8386620a38af4b1cbb2d9e19c164:1

value
46225
script pubkey
OP_0 OP_PUSHBYTES_20 85fbcdd47ef780d7be21746b31c2df170060bcaf
address
tb1qshaum4r777qd003pw34nrsklzuqxp090zaam4s
transaction
3fd89f3ff156143de936f89bad7523d3dc2e8386620a38af4b1cbb2d9e19c164
confirmations
72767
spent
true